12. Essays on Art Markets : insight from the international sculpture auction market
Sammanfattning : The main purpose of this thesis is to investigate the viability of sculpture as a potential alternative investment. This goal is achieved through partly assessing the market quality of the auction market for sculptures and partly by studying their long-run diversification potential. LÄS MER

14. Retirement Planning: Portfolio Choice for Long-Term Investors
Sammanfattning : This thesis consists of four papers. Common to the first three papers is the framework for analysis; a life-cycle model of a borrowing-constrained individual's consumption- and portfolio choices in the presence of uncertain labour income.
